squidoo marketingNow you can promote your niche by creating lenses in Squidoo.com. Squidoo has a lot of tools available that will help you start building a new niche and promote it quickly and creatively. Having lenses is one good way to create backlinks and send traffic to your website. The strategy is called Squidoo marketing

All it takes is to register to a free account on Squidoo and start building lenses. Squidoo is considered as one of the most powerful niche marketing tools. You can build as many niche lenses as you want and promote as many affiliate products and services.

While you can have plenty of lenses on your account, you can also sign up on as many user accounts. This has been proven to be an effective strategy when marketing your niches. It is advisable to sign up to as many accounts and devote each to a particular niche. This helps you track your related niches on one account.

Having an unlimited number of accounts on Squidoo allows you to organize and focus exclusively on your audience response. It gives you an idea which keyword has the most number of searches. One lens should talk about a certain topic and must have a list of the right keywords. The keywords should be relevant to your topic and must be well-researched to be able to help lead your audience towards your niche lens. Build you lens around related tags either in word or in phrases. This allows search engines identify your topic lens and get traffic to visit them.

To further promote your lenses, you can join Squidoo groups that are relevant to your niche. Exchange ideas and insights in Squidoo.com/groups by joining there. You can visit their lenses and leave comments and reviews about their lens. This is a nice way of requesting other members to drop by your lenses too. If you are smarter enough, insert your link in your comment casually without sounding too sales pitchy. This way, other lensmasters can visit your lens too and that means traffic and promotion.

Creating feeds have also been made possible with Squidoo’s RSS feeds feature. You can tie it up with your blog to get updates on your lens. All you have to do is add the RSS module and copy and paste the feed from your site into that module.

Doing this will attract more traffic into your website and will help you close a sale. Your lens is one source of traffic towards your site. When your visitors are interested to find out more of what you offer in your lens, they will click through you link towards your website or affiliate site.

When you make a lens on Squidoo, treat it like your own website. You work hard for search engine optimization too. You need to promote it and freshen it up regularly to experience the benefits of Squidoo marketing.

Every good thing has its flaws and the same applies to Social Media. The world has embraced the new tools helping thousands of people to interact and distance is no longer a barrier. According to statistics young people form the bulk of the fan base of the social medial outlets. As an entrepreneur there are some top cons that you have to face when employing the services of different social media and these are some of them.

News in the social media spread like bushfire around the world because of the viral potential of the media. This is the case even when the news are negative or in bad taste. One malicious posting from an individual can cause the good name of your company to be tarnished in a matter of hours. The problem with such this viral spread of the message is that the damage caused might be irreversible.

Building a brand through the social media is a lengthy process as it is continuous. A business will have to spend a lot of time updating its audience on the relevant issues and the updates could come in by the hour. When you are established and pull a large crowd, it will be a laborious process trying to meet the needs of all the people in your crowd.

Social media is about give and take and the law of reciprocity applies here. When a user has a response to an update you’ve given you should be there to reply to their queries enough to satisfy the curiosity. If this is not done properly, the audience will lose their faith in you and will reflect poorly on you.

Social media by nature changes constantly and there is a need to stay abreast with upcoming sites and make the necessary change. This is the only way you are able to safeguard the interest of your business.
